Know before you go

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Grotta Delle Trabacche.

  • Visit early in the morning or late in the afternoon to enjoy cooler temperatures and better lighting for photography.
  • Wear comfortable shoes, as the terrain can be uneven and requires some hiking.
  • Bring water and snacks, as there are limited facilities in the area.
  • Look out for local wildlife; the area is home to various bird species and other animals.

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, start by navigating to Ragusa, which is the nearest city to Grotta Delle Trabacche. From Palermo, take the A19 highway toward Catania, then merge onto the A18 toward Siracusa. Exit at Ragusa and follow signs to the city center. Once in Ragusa, continue on Via Roma and then turn onto Via della Libertà. Follow this road until you reach the outskirts of Ragusa. Look for signs for Grotta Delle Trabacche, which is approximately 15 minutes from the city center. Be aware that there may be a small parking fee in the area.

  • Public Transportation

    To reach Grotta Delle Trabacche using public transportation, take a train from your starting location in Sicily to Ragusa. From Catania, you can catch a train from the Catania Centrale station to Ragusa. Once you arrive in Ragusa, you will need to take a local bus (line 1 or 2) towards the outskirts of the city. Make sure to ask the bus driver to stop at Grotta Delle Trabacche. The bus ride will take approximately 30 minutes. Note that there may be a small fee for the bus ticket, usually around €1.50.

  • Taxi or Ride Share

    For a more convenient option, consider taking a taxi or using a ride-sharing service from Ragusa to Grotta Delle Trabacche. Simply request a ride to the destination using your preferred app or find a taxi in the city center. The cost for this ride should be around €20-25, depending on traffic and time of day. This is a great option if you're traveling with a group or have limited time.

Discover more about Grotta Delle Trabacche

Nestled in the beautiful region of Ragusa, Grotta Delle Trabacche is an open-air museum that captivates the imagination of every visitor. This extraordinary location showcases a series of stunning caves and rock formations, which have been sculpted by nature over centuries. As you wander through this breathtaking area, you’ll find yourself immersed in the serene atmosphere, surrounded by lush greenery and the melodic sounds of nature. The breathtaking cliffs and panoramic views offer excellent photo opportunities, making it a favorite spot for photographers and nature enthusiasts alike. Grotta Delle Trabacche is not just a visual delight but also a treasure trove of historical significance. The site has been a witness to various cultures and civilizations that have thrived in this region, leaving behind fascinating remnants of their existence. As you explore, take a moment to ponder the stories these ancient rocks could tell. The blend of natural beauty and historical depth makes Grotta Delle Trabacche a unique destination that appeals to tourists of all ages. For those looking to enhance their experience, guided tours are available, providing insights into the geology and history of the area.
